- [ ] Step 7: Archive cold storage buckets (Glacierline tier). Confirm both ceremony witnesses are present, verify bucket manifests match the Oxbow ledger, then seal the archive key shares. Plugin authors may observe but not handle shares. Once sealed, the archive index itself is encrypted and can only be reopened with the passphrase below.

vault phrase of badup-hahig = tamael-aldael-kelmir-istael-fenok-istwyn-tamius-jorath-oliion

Runbook: Account recovery — LoomORM refactor service account

For the release manager. If the migration bot account for the LoomORM legacy refactor gets locked (usually after schema-diff job retries), do this: stop the migration queue, confirm no half-applied changesets in the ledger table, then trigger account recovery from the Harkness admin console. Approve the reset, re-run the smoke migration on staging, restart the queue. The console will prompt for the recovery passphrase, which is as follows.

unlock words, hahip-baduf: holwyn-istath-julvan

Quarterly Planning Note — Headcount, Next Year

Finance team: planned headcount lands at 188, up 14. Additions concentrated in the Orvane platform group and one analyst for treasury. No growth in facilities or admin. Salary budget assumes 4% merit pool. Contractor spend trimmed 12% to offset. Final sign-off expected at the Hallowell review. The underlying plan driving these numbers appears below.

management briefing: Istaelix Group is in early talks to buy Sorysax Logistics for about $496.2 million. The Kasox launch date is October 3, and nothing goes to the press before then. Legal wants the Norokax Foods term sheet withdrawn before April 25.